Does anyone know a way to get discounted hotel rooms at the hard rock hotel? I, uh, just don't want to pay full price. Thanks.

I would recommend joining the "Player's Club" as they send out periodic mailings with discounted room prices. The lowest price I saw in one of those mailings was 99.00 per night.

Since the Seminole Hard Rock Hotel is an independent and not a chain like Hilton or Hyatt, they don't offer any rewards programs, aside from the "Player's Club".
